Stimulants

Adult ADHD is usually treated by using stimulants. They increase brain levels of dopamine norepinephrine and other neurotransmitters. These neurotransmitters play a vital part in the body's ability think and react. In turn, they help with focus short-term memory and reaction time. However they also have some side effects.

A fast heart beat is among the most frequent adverse effects. It's usually mild and doesn't cause significant clinical changes. If you experience this side effect, you may need to decrease the dosage or stop taking it altogether. Another possibility is that you experience insomnia. To avoid the possibility of experiencing this side effect, begin by establishing good sleeping habits. It is possible to reduce the time you drink stimulants by avoiding taking them in the afternoon.

There are two major classes of stimulants. The short-acting stimulants start working within a matter of hours after being taken in. In general, the stimulants with longer acting take a little more time to start working. They can be more expensive , however they are less likely to cause adverse consequences. The typical long-acting medicine can be taken once a day.

Utilizing stimulants to treat ADHD can result in changes in your blood pressure. If you have this problem, you may need to have your blood pressure regularly checked. Typically, you'll see a slight increase in your pulse and blood pressure. However, in certain cases the increase may be significant, and you should seek medical treatment.
